Overcoming the Viscosity-Strength Trade-Off in 3D-Printable Dental Resins by Hydrogen Bond Engineering

Summary

Researchers developed a hydrogen-bond engineering strategy to create dental resins for 3D printing. This approach successfully decoupled viscosity from mechanical strength, yielding low-viscosity, high-strength materials for improved dental applications.
